Carrying the wooden ladder, Fu Anan walked inside in a slightly lighter mood. However, as she got closer to the shipping container, a foul smell faintly lingered in her nostrils.

Fu Anan sniffed the air. She thought that the air would be better on the upper deck of the ship. She found a face towel and covered her nose, then continued in the direction she had chosen.

Outside the small shed, Fu Yizhi opened the door. He coldly looked at the person at the entrance.

“S-Sir.”

Seeing Fu Anan leaving, Sun Caiyan deliberately stood at the door. She looked at Fu Yizhi, a bit probing and flattering.

It didn’t matter if Fu Anan didn’t want her anymore. The man in front of her was handsome and good. The most important thing was that he still had a gun! In just one glance, Sun Caiyan made him her goal in her heart.

“Sir, can you take me in?” Sun Caiyan showed her most delicate and charming side. She pitifully looked at Fu Yizhi, “There was a misunderstanding between me and my companion. Now, I’m all alone. It’s dark and terrifying outside.”

Fu Yizhi didn’t even respond to her. He treated her as if she were invisible.

Sun Caiyan bit her lip. She clasped her hands together and pleaded to Fu Yizhi, “Sir, I can’t survive on my own. I don’t know how much longer the cargo ship will take to dock. Please, I beg you to help me.”

“Scram.”

The door slammed shut.

Being dismissed like air, Sun Caiyan clamped her lips in anger. She cast a resentful glance at the closed door before walking away.

Meanwhile, Fu Anan continued carrying the wooden ladder towards the shipping container.

However, as she approached the center of the rows and rows of stacked containers, the stench grew stronger. The smell was particularly similar to the rotting smell of corpses on the lower deck.

Fu Anan’s footsteps slowed down……

The shipping containers were stacked very high. Fu Anan was standing at the very bottom. She looked at the dark-red container beside her.

The bottom of the container had already rusted, and the rusty water gathered around and corroded the outside of the container. The identification number on it was also blurry and it was difficult to make out its original appearance. Fu Anan was about to walk away when she suddenly noticed a hole had been broken in the corner of a container. Something inside the container was moving.

Curiosity made her squat down and slowly approach to get a clearer view of what was inside.

CLANK.

A pale and mangled finger extended from the hole, with fresh red nail polish on the fingertip. The stiff finger twisted and hooked in the air, scraping off flesh as it met the sharp edges of the hole. Dark blood slowly oozed out from it.

Fu Anan took out her kitchen knife and gently nudged the finger.

Suddenly, there was a violent impact coming from within the container.

This sound was like a drop of water falling into hot oil, causing a massive reaction. Things inside dozens of containers couldn’t bear the loneliness anymore. The distinctive howls of zombies, banging noises, and the scraping of nails against the container walls sounded……

These sounds surrounded Fu Anan, making her scalp tingle.

Holy sh*t! 

Fu Anan dropped the wooden ladder and quickly ran back.

“Master Fu, bad news! All the containers in Zone B are filled with zombies!”

Fu Anan wiped the cold sweat from her forehead. She shut all the doors and windows of the small shed tightly.

Fu Yizhi wasn’t surprised to hear this. He remained calm and said, “Not only in Zone B, but also in the four major zones. Around 70% of the containers are filled with zombies.”

Being a day ahead of Fu Anan here, Fu Yizhi had already surveyed the entire top deck.

70%!

Now it was Fu Anan’s turn to have a breakdown.

She had risked her life, thinking that the top deck was relatively safe, only to end up walking straight into the zombie nest.

Fu Anan sat down on the ground in exhaustion. She silently wiped away a tear, “This damn game is so disgusting. It doesn’t tell you anything and just lets you step on landmines. How many zombies must there be in seven layers of containers?”

Fu Yizhi, “Probably around 20,000.”

“How did you know? Did you count them?”
